by Stallion » Mon Jul 28, 2008 9:18 pm
They don't enroll until January. Greyshirts occur when you go over the 25(per year)/85(per roster) rule.

by pony warrior » Tue Jul 29, 2008 11:29 am
Stallion wrote:They don't enroll until January. Greyshirts occur when you go over the 25(per year)/85(per roster) rule.
Will they have to cut the roster down from 105 to 85? How do they do that?
-
pony warrior

-
- Posts: 229
- Joined: Thu Apr 10, 2008 1:00 pm
by Stallion » Tue Jul 29, 2008 11:51 am
they don't have to cut the Roster down. You can have 85 scholarship players and something like 15-20 preffered walkons in camp from the first day of fall practice until the first day of school classes. After school starts all other walkons can join the team.
